One embodiment of the present invention relates to a method for improving the power consumption of a transmission chain by varying the operating point of a power amplifier to optimize (e.g., reduce) the current that is consumed by the amplifier. The operating point is varied by changing the bias voltage(s) (e.g., supply voltage, quiescent voltage) of the amplifier to a predetermined value that is chosen based upon the effect that a given transmitted signal modulation scheme characteristic (e.g., channel bandwidth and/or number of subcarriers) has on the operating point of a power amplifier. For example, if the characteristics indicate a good power amplifier performance the linear output power capability of a power amplifier can be lowered, by changing the bias voltage(s) supplied to the power amplifier, to reduce the output power capability and current consumption of the power amplifier. |
